Coimbatore: Thousands of devotees in Coimbatore offered prayers on the occasion of the famous Dandu Mariamman temple festival.

On the 18th of this month, the ancient Dandu Mariamman temple festival on Avinashi Road in Coimbatore began. Following that, specific poojas are performed on a daily basis. This was followed by the main event of the fire pots, mik pots, and beak piercing ceremony.



More than 3,000 devotees participated in the procession, carrying fire pots, beaks and milk pots. The procession, which started at The Koniamman Temple in Coimbatore, passed through Oppanakara Road, reached Avinashi Road and culminated at Dandu Mariamman Temple.



Along the way, people offered drinking water, water buttermilk, soft drinks and pulp to the devotees.



Moreover, many people poured water on the feet of those who paid obeisance and sought their blessings.

Coimbatore City Police Commissioner Balakrishnan led the police personnel on duty to mark the occasion. The traffic police also undertook the task of clearing the traffic through loudspeakers.
